Sunderland have set out plans to raise standards at the Academy of Light as they begin recruiting a new Academy Manager. Robin Nicholls will leave after four years to take up a role at New York City FC this summer.

The club’s advert frames the role as building on strong foundations, with a push for elite recruitment, quicker development and regular progression into first-team football or other high-value outcomes. It stresses the focus is not firefighting or rebuilding systems, but raising the ceiling across the pathway.

Sunderland are again using the Executives in Sport Group to run the process, having previously worked with them on key hires such as Krisjtaan Speakman’s appointment as sporting director in 2020.

The successful candidate will report to director of football Florent Ghisolfi. Applications close on the first of May, with an appointment expected to be finalised before the summer.
